Can't tell where your traveler is from the photo. On my H30, I removed the cam cleats, lengthened the line, and mounted new cleats on the cabin aft edge. Now I can play the traveler from the helm, along with the vang and main sheet. Learning how to vary the mainsail in this way keeps me from reefing until at least 20kts, maybe more.
